To give a boost to the campaign of BJP, Prime Minister Narendra Modi is expected to arrive in poll-bound Tripura on February 11 and on 13.

Sources said that PM Modi to address two mass gatherings in the poll-bound state and would address mega mass gatherings on February 11 and 13.

On February 11 the PM would address the mass gathering at R K Pur under Udaipur Sub-division of Gomati district at 12 PM while another gathering will address at Ambassa in the Dhalai district.

Though no other information has arrived yet regarding the visit of PM Modi on the 13th he is likely to address a gathering at Bagbassa in the North district.

While BJP National President JP Nadda is arriving in Tripura on February 9 to release the poll manifesto of the party for the election.

Meanwhile, Union Defence Minister Rajnath Singh on February 8 claimed that massive development works have been done in Tripura ever since the BJP came into power.

He said this while addressing a public gathering on February 8 at Rajnagar constituency in Tripura.

''The BJP party has worked for all-round development of the state and if voted to power, the party will deliver more in the next five years,'' he added.

Mentioning the significant task undertaken during Atal Bihari Vajpayee’s government, Rajnath Singh stated people residing near the borders do not face any problems as the Vajpayee’s government had set up fencing along the Tripura-Bangladesh border, a task which the Congress-CPI(M) party couldn’t do during their tenure in Tripura.

“I would love to extend my gratitude to the people of Tripura who helped BJP to defeat CPI(M) in 2018 and form government in the state,” Sing said.
